Déplacer Mes Documents par défaut et par script

Optimisation de Windows, modification du bureau.
Alain Quarré
Messages : 965
Enregistré le : mer. 20 janv. 2010 23:41
Etes vous un robot ? : Non

Re: Déplacer Mes Documents par défaut et par script

Message par Alain Quarré »

Je voulais répondre hier soir, mais le divan à eu raison de moi...
Biostrider a écrit :quand tu veux dire "par défaut", tu parle de windows ou uniquement de ton exemple.
Uniquement dans mon exemple
Biostrider a écrit : Biostrider a écrit:Pourquoi Historique est le seul *Hide-Sys?
Je peux très bien le désactiver? Non?
Bien-sûr que cela peut être désactivé. c'est là l’intérêt de la modularité du script.
Biostrider a écrit :Est-ce que cela veux dire que si je me trompe je n'ai qu'a (re)modifier le fichier INI, et relancer le script autant de fois que je le souhaites jusqu'au résultat souhaité? Cela ne rique-t-il pas de fiche en l'air Windows?
Oui, c'est comme cela que tu dois tester.
Tu dois relancer le script et recréer un utilisateur à chaque fois.
comme dit plus haut, je l'ai fait plusieurs dizaines de fois sur mon PC
Pour rappel, le script modifie UNIQUEMENT la ruche du default user, et ce, dans deux endroits différents de cette ruche:
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ders pour la position des dossiers utilisateur
Software\Microsoft\Windows\CurrentVersion\RunOnce pour le lancement unique du script de jonction
Neanmoins: Un système prévu pour test est préférable car tu devras au final effacer tous les utilisateurs créés.
(Une fois que j'ai ce que je souhaite, je créer mon utilisateur final et je lance le script Jonctions.cmd?)
Le script de jonction se lance tout seul et de manière unique au premier log d'un utilisateur.
tachou66 a écrit : j'attends vos réponses pour ajouter mes applications au système.
Tu peux tester, Biosrider a bien répondu à tes questions.==>
Biostrider a écrit : il faut voir ce script comme un programme réalisant toute la manip' à ta place
Biostrider a écrit :Que se passe-t-il si je mais le statut "NoUserName*Security". J'aurais un dossier commun avec tous les utilisateurs mais je serais le seul à pouvoir y accéder :?: Bizarre :|
cela est évidement prévu. Si il y a NoUsername, la paramètre Sécurity n'est pas pris en compte. (un dossier commun avec un utilisateur unique n'a pas de sens!)
En clair, pour que la sécurité soit appliquée, il faut le paramètre Addusername ET le paramètre Security.
Voir ligne 154 à 160 du script de jonctions.
Biostrider a écrit :Tant que j'y suis... Est-ce que le script créé les dossiers intermédiaires si ces derniers n'existent pas?
C'est Windows qui créés les dossiers au premier log d'un utilisateur, pas le script.
tachou66 a écrit :suite a deux interventions pour une hernie discale qui n'est toujours pas solutionnée
He ben ma poule, bon courage!
Biostrider a écrit :Quant à Alain j'imagine qu'il doit avoir beaucoup de boulot. Je compte juste sur ce week-end pour avoir un petit coucou de sa part...
cette semaine a été assez chargée, de fait.

Biostrider a écrit : Cette question sur les attributs NoUserName et Security me turlupine. Même en relisant l'intégralité de ce sujet, je n'ai pas trouvé ma réponse.
Tu n'as pas bien lu, car comme le dis tachou66
tachou66 a écrit : je pense qu'il doit être assez perfectionniste afin de donner les bonnes réponses.
tu peux lire dans le premeir post:
Alain Quarré a écrit :Dans le fichier PositionDefaultFolderSevenModular.ini, si le champ 3 est AddUsername ET le champ 4 est Security,
Je reconnais quand même que ce n'est pas écrit très grand!

Bon WE

Alain
Déplacer les dossiers utilisateur topic4073.html topic5883.html
Déplacer le dossier Public topic4396.html
PAS DE RÉPONSE TECHNIQUE PAR MP
Biostrider
Messages : 18
Enregistré le : lun. 2 avr. 2012 18:19
Etes vous un robot ? : Non

Re: Déplacer Mes Documents par défaut et par script

Message par Biostrider »

Bonjour Alain et un grand merci. Ton absence a largement était compensé par l'exhaustivité de ta réponse.

Cependant je t'envoie une (deux) petite(s) dernière(s) question(s) pour la route ( ;) ) :
Le script de jonction se lance tout seul et de manière unique au premier log d'un utilisateur.
Cela veut-il dire qu'il faut le placer à un endroit dans Windows en particulier ou bien le script de base se charge aussi de cela?
C'est Windows qui créés les dossiers au premier log d'un utilisateur, pas le script.
Question inverse : Mais si les dossiers existent cela ne devrait pas poser de problème?

Voilà! Après ça je te laisse tranquille (enfin normalement). Mon Compte LABO ainsi que mon fichier INI sont (presque) pret! Il n'y aura plus qu'à lancer!!!
tachou66
Messages : 19
Enregistré le : jeu. 5 avr. 2012 11:00
Etes vous un robot ? : Non

Re: Déplacer Mes Documents par défaut et par script

Message par tachou66 »

Ben voilà, il est ressuscité notre prodige! Tu m'étonnes, avec Pâques cela va de soit.
Biostrider,Je te laisse a tes méditations , a tes explorations, et rends moi un rapport parfait de cette expérimentation...Hug!
Je ne te laisse pas tomber, mon bon ami, mais j'en ai ma claque aujourd'hui. Cela fait des heures que je recherche ( y a des CD égarés, des codes d'installation plutôt "fugitifs...") , que je réinstalle ma panoplie de logiciel. Évidemment il y a parfois problème.
Le weekend est là et ma moitié ne va pas apprécier que je planche nuit et jour sur ma machine...Soyons compréhensif et pour la paix des ménages.
Quand on commence ce genre d'intervention, il faut qu'elle soit bien planifiée de façon a ne pas s'arrêter en route.
Je m'excuse si tu déblais le terrain, mais nul doute que je vais introduire ce script d'une façon personnalisée qui va ressembler a la tienne.
Si tu as un résultat d'ici là, fais en nous part.
A suivre, repos maintenant.
Alain Quarré
Messages : 965
Enregistré le : mer. 20 janv. 2010 23:41
Etes vous un robot ? : Non

Re: Déplacer Mes Documents par défaut et par script

Message par Alain Quarré »

Biostrider a écrit :Cela veut-il dire qu'il faut le placer à un endroit dans Windows en particulier ou bien le script de base se charge aussi de cela?
tout est automatique, pratique non?
Biostrider a écrit :Question inverse : Mais si les dossiers existent cela ne devrait pas poser de problème?
Non, cela ne pose pas de problème. tu le confirmeras après test tests

@tachou66
Tu as toujours ton AmiloXi 3650?

Alain
Déplacer les dossiers utilisateur topic4073.html topic5883.html
Déplacer le dossier Public topic4396.html
PAS DE RÉPONSE TECHNIQUE PAR MP
Biostrider
Messages : 18
Enregistré le : lun. 2 avr. 2012 18:19
Etes vous un robot ? : Non

Re: Déplacer Mes Documents par défaut et par script

Message par Biostrider »

Eh bien je viens de lancer le script pour la première fois et j'ai le message suivant :
Le champ AddUserName ou NoUserName n'est pas correct dans PositionDefaultFolderSevenModular.ini
Veuillez vérifier
Appuyer sur une touche pour continuer...
Bon bah... No comment! J'essaye de tout comprendre et finalement je ne comprend pas tout! :|

Ps : je préciserais que j'ai essayé de tous mettre en "NoUserName*NoSecurity" mais même message d'erreur. :hein:
Alain Quarré
Messages : 965
Enregistré le : mer. 20 janv. 2010 23:41
Etes vous un robot ? : Non

Re: Déplacer Mes Documents par défaut et par script

Message par Alain Quarré »

La casse est prise en compte, attention au majuscule, minuscule
(je modifierai le script pour que cela ne soit plus le cas)

Post ici ton fichier .ini
le script showinifile peut aussi t'aider

Alain
Modifié en dernier par Alain Quarré le sam. 7 avr. 2012 20:23, modifié 1 fois.
Déplacer les dossiers utilisateur topic4073.html topic5883.html
Déplacer le dossier Public topic4396.html
PAS DE RÉPONSE TECHNIQUE PAR MP
Biostrider
Messages : 18
Enregistré le : lun. 2 avr. 2012 18:19
Etes vous un robot ? : Non

Re: Déplacer Mes Documents par défaut et par script

Message par Biostrider »

Voilà le premier que j'ai essayer

Mes Documents*Personal*AddUsername*Security*Documents*H:\Documents sur AMBER
Mes images*My Pictures*NoUsername*NoSecurity*Pictures*H:\Documents sur AMBER
Mes vid‚os*My Video*NoUsername*NoSecurity*Videos*G:\Vidéos sur AMBER
Ma musique*My Music*NoUsername*NoSecurity*Music*H:\Documents sur AMBER
<Bureau*Desktop*AddUserName*Security*Desktop*D:\Documents
Favoris*Favorites*AddUsername*Security*Favorites*H:\Documents sur AMBER
T‚l‚chargements*{374DE290-123F-4565-9164-39C4925E467B}*NoUsername*NoSecurity*Downloads*F:\Téléchargements sur AMBER
Parties enregistr‚es*{4C5C32FF-BB9D-43B0-B5B4-2D72E54EAAA4}*AddUsername*NoSecurity*Saved Games*H:\Documents sur AMBER
Contacts*{56784854-C6CB-462B-8169-88E350ACB882}*AddUsername*Security*Contacts*H:\Documents sur AMBER
<Recherches*{7D1D3A04-DEBB-4115-95CF-2F29DA2920DA}*AddUserName*Security*Searches*D:\Documents
<Liens*{BFB9D5E0-C6A9-404C-B2B2-AE6DB6AF4968}*AddUserName*Security*Links*D:\Documents
<Ordinateurs virtuels*{B5947D7F-B489-4FDE-9E77-23780CC610D1}*NoUserName*NoSecurity*Virtual Machines*D:\Documents
Cookies*Cookies*AddUserName*Security*Cookies*D:\Temp (D)
Historique*History*AddUserName*Security*History*D:\Temp (D)
Cache Internet explorer*Cache*AddUserName*Security*Temporary Internet Files*D:\Temp (D)
CD Burning*CD Burning*NoUserName*NoSecurity*Burn*D:\Temp (D)

Je vais tester le script...
Biostrider
Messages : 18
Enregistré le : lun. 2 avr. 2012 18:19
Etes vous un robot ? : Non

Re: Déplacer Mes Documents par défaut et par script

Message par Biostrider »

La casse est prise en compte, attention au majuscule, minuscule
OK du coup je vois ou est le problème

Je réessaye et je te tiens au courant!
Alain Quarré
Messages : 965
Enregistré le : mer. 20 janv. 2010 23:41
Etes vous un robot ? : Non

Re: Déplacer Mes Documents par défaut et par script

Message par Alain Quarré »

Modifie la ligne 81 du script comme suit

Code : Tout sélectionner

        If /I NOT %%c == AddUserName If /I Not %%c == NoUserName goto UsernameSetting
et la ligne 85

Code : Tout sélectionner

        If /I NOT %%d == Security If /I Not %%d == NoSecurity goto SecuritySetting
et tu n'auras plus ce problème de casse.

Alain
Déplacer les dossiers utilisateur topic4073.html topic5883.html
Déplacer le dossier Public topic4396.html
PAS DE RÉPONSE TECHNIQUE PAR MP
Biostrider
Messages : 18
Enregistré le : lun. 2 avr. 2012 18:19
Etes vous un robot ? : Non

Re: Déplacer Mes Documents par défaut et par script

Message par Biostrider »

Re,
Modifie la ligne 81 du script comme suit
houla! Tu m'en demmande beaucoup là!
et tu n'auras plus ce problème de casse
Je viens de modifier le fichier INI. Cela devrait fonctionner maintenant... Je m'en vais essayer!!!

PS :
La casse est prise en compte, attention au majuscule, minuscule
Et les accents que j'ai inclus dans les dossiers que je veux que Windows créé? Comme par exemple : "Téléchargements sur AMBER"?
Répondre